Ryanair says its introduced new measures to protect customers from scams.
The "Know Your Passenger" initiative will make sure the person setting up a Ryanair account is real.
The company says it'll help stop "ghost brokering", "phishing" and other scams that prevent the airline from sending emails to passengers while the scammer overcharges them.
From today, customers will have to complete a once-off verification.
